What sector employs most Americans?

What sector employs most Americans?

In 2021, the education and health services industry employed the largest number of people in the United States. That year, about 34.7 million people were employed in the education and health services industry.

What sector dominates the US economy?

The U.S. economy features a highly-developed and technologically-advanced services sector, which accounts for about 80% of its output. The U.S. economy is dominated by services-oriented companies in areas such as technology, financial services, healthcare and retail.

    What is current employment statistics program?

    The Current Employment Statistics (CES) program is a monthly survey of business establishments (or jobs). CES produces estimates on the number of employees on nonfarm payrolls, average hourly earnings, average weekly earnings, and average weekly hours. The Current Population Survey (CPS) is a monthly survey of households (or people).
